IP查询
查询
你查询的IP:[123.101.4.202] 地理位置:中国–河南–郑州
最新查询
124.64.148.103
125.215.207.211
117.112.176.227
116.2.80.254
117.22.211.97
116.60.107.18
125.64.113.203
121.16.174.107
119.177.193.79
123.101.4.202
123.100.61.28
116.199.247.117
192.83.169.107
220.152.128.17
116.215.254.197
221.198.105.0
219.242.74.253
210.51.30.137
203.93.222.194
121.4.158.203
202.192.221.132
203.166.160.36
60.200.154.255
116.112.6.33
122.240.115.89
123.244.7.237
119.27.192.149
116.1.52.211
119.2.23.57
202.38.149.69
118.239.39.131